Run npm start or npm run dev to start the development server (at localhost:4321).
Run npm run build to build the application. The built code will be on a dist folder.
Run npm run preview to server the built code.

Astro looks for .astro or .md files in the src/pages/ directory. Each page is exposed as a route based on its file name.
Any static assets, like images, can be placed in the public/ directory.
